I commenced my journey in the early learning sector in 2012. During my experience in the early childhood education sector, I have held various roles, including the Educational Leader, responsible for guiding quality practice and programming. In January 2023, I joined Golden Bay as the Centre Manager. I hold a Diploma in Children's services.
My passion is to provide children with a rich learning environment that encourages them to have fun and develop their emerging interests, abilities, and strengths. Educators are responsible for giving children opportunities to develop life skills, engage in age-appropriate challenges and make decisions about their learning journey. I work hard to ensure that every child is respected and valued as an individual in our community.
The early years (birth to five) are the foundational years for children to build on social and emotional development. By attending a dedicated early learning environment, your child will have the stepping stones to build their identity, resilience and independence before heading off to formal schooling.
